Description

BACKGROUND AND PURPOSE OF THE PROCUREMENT RailStock Finland Oy (hereinafter “Railstock”) is launching a tendering procedure for technical consultancy services related to the rolling stock it manages. The purpose of this procurement is to establish a framework for obtaining high‑quality, independent technical consultancy services that support Railstock in the management, development and procurement of rolling stock used in publicly funded passenger rail services in Finland. CONTRACTING ENTITY Railstock Finland Oy is a company wholly owned by the State of Finland, which manages, develops and leases passenger rolling stock for publicly funded passenger rail services in Finland. The objective of the company is to ensure that the rolling stock used in contracted services is safe, modern, low‑emission and available to all operators on equal and transparent terms, so that competition in rail transport and sustainable modes of transport can develop. Railstock is responsible for the preparation and implementation of new rolling stock procurements, for lifecycle management of the rolling stock and for long‑term investment planning. The company began operating as an independent company under the ownership steering of the Prime Minister’s Office in November 2025, and practical operational activities have commenced during 2026 as rolling stock used in contracted services, transferred from VR and other parties, is brought into the company’s ownership. SCOPE OF THE PROCUREMENT The subject matter of the procurement is a comprehensive package of technical expert and consultancy services related to rolling stock, supporting the rolling stock owner in, inter alia, technical assessments, procurement preparation, lifecycle management, planning of maintenance and heavy overhauls, safety and approval matters, as well as other expert tasks connected with the ownership and development of rolling stock.
